Search Continues for Missing Girl in East River

A 15-year-old girl went missing in New York City's East River near Roosevelt Island on Friday after reportedly entering the water around 12:15 p.m., possibly to retrieve a dropped phone or after slipping from rocks, according to witnesses. She was last seen wearing a floral bathing suit, and her friend called 911 after being unable to help her. Rescue efforts by NYPD, FDNY, and the Coast Guard involved divers, boats, and helicopters, but the hazardous currents and worsening weather hampered the search. Several belongings, including clothing, books, and a bag, were recovered at the scene. As of Friday evening, the girl had not been found, and officials have shifted from rescue to recovery efforts. Police do not suspect foul play, but the incident remains under investigation.
